CSE571: AI-based Mobile Robotics

Credits
3
Catalog description
Overview of mobile robot control and sensing. Behavior-based control, world modeling, localization, navigation, and planning Probabilistic sensor interpretation, Bayers filters, particle filters. Projects: Program real robots to perform navigation tasks.
Prerequisites
CSE major and CSE 473, or permission of instructor.
